FES Nepal
Office
|
Formally established in Nepal on November
2, 1995, the Friedrich Ebert Foundation Office is located
in Sanepa, Lalitpur, headed by a Resident Representative.
It had been providing scholarship support
to young Nepali students in the fields of political education,
social science research, political dialogue, training
on mass media and communication and general education
even before its office was formally established in Nepal.
Its activities in Nepal can be broadly classified as follows:
- Encouragement to the growth of democratic
institutions and instruments in order to improve their
capability in the formation of a democratic political
culture.
- Promotion of dialogue on various
issues concerning Nepals environment, decentralization
and good governance, civic education, women and development,
economic policies, foreign aid, social issues, consumer
rights, role of NGOs and civil society and international
co-operation.
- Improvement of labour welfare, discussion
of working conditions, training on industrial relations
system, health and safety for workers, labour economics,
women and informal sector, organization and management,
leadership training, collective bargaining and responsibilities
of workers.
- Scholarship support to promising
young Nepali intellectuals to get exposure, training
and education abroad.
Capacity building of mass media agencies,
different departments of Tribhuvan University and local
NGOs with material help, donation of books, fax machines,
photo-copiers, computers, printers and other equipment.
FES has supported its partner organizations in Nepal in
publishing books on matters of policy, as well as of general
and academic interest. Notable among them are areas such
as Nepali economy, development, foreign aid and debt,
civil society, women and development, NGOs, environment,
decentralization and local self-government, civic education,
industrial relations, World Trade Organization (WTO),
impact of globalization on Nepal, Nepal and South Asian
Association for Regional Co-operation (SAARC), Nepals
foreign policy, social development, media and democracy.
Promotion of regional co-operation in
South Asia. In this context, the Coalition for Action
on South Asian Co-operation (CASAC), an NGO with regional
dimension, works in co-operation with the FES in promoting
regional co-operation, development and peace in South
Asia.
In sum, the FES Nepal works in the following
fields:
- Democratization
- Trade Union Development
- Media Development
- Regional Co-operation in South Asia
- Conflict Resolution
- Good Governance
- Gender
